Transaction 29065b59adc2847fa6d63ef86cd1a5d3809a2ee7c82b1cb43a40280f4438cc1b

3 Input
2 Outputs
  • 29065b59adc2847fa6d63ef86cd1a5d3809a2ee7c82b1cb43a40280f4438cc1b:0
  • value  538360
    address  3F5HbPbKuJWs7qaUiBHHig2cN38oqpZTUx
  • 29065b59adc2847fa6d63ef86cd1a5d3809a2ee7c82b1cb43a40280f4438cc1b:1
  • value  2563050
    address  3HgZLZ2bP5mFigHgj4aXaFd4ipgsYqW7rk